Letta, founded by the creators of MemGPT from UC Berkeley's Sky Computing Lab, is at the forefront of developing self-improving artificial intelligence. The company focuses on creating agents that continually learn from experience and adapt over time, already powering production systems at companies like 11x and BILT Rewards.

As a Research Engineer/Scientist in Self-Improvement, you'll be tackling AI's hardest problems, working on foundational methods that enable AI systems to learn and evolve through experience. The role involves developing novel memory systems, context management techniques, and agent architectures that push the boundaries of AI capabilities towards human-like learning.

The position is based in downtown San Francisco, requiring full-time in-person presence 5 days a week. You'll be joining a world-class, tight-knit team of AI researchers and engineers, working in a flat organizational structure where everyone contributes as an individual contributor.

Key research areas include Memory & Learning Systems, Agent Architectures, and Open Research & Impact. The ideal candidate will have deep expertise in machine learning, particularly in LLMs and continual learning, with a proven track record of impactful research. The role requires someone who thrives in ambiguity, can drive their own agenda, and is willing to work beyond traditional hours to achieve breakthrough results.

This is an opportunity to be part of a potentially transformative company in its early stages, similar to being at OpenAI when it was just starting. The company values direct customer engagement, cross-stack work, and maintains a strong stance against closed frontier AI controlled by private tech companies. The interview process includes an initial screen, technical screen, and a paid in-person work trial in San Francisco.
